## Changelog — v2.7.0

Welcome aboard! A few things landed in VaultSpinner, our in-house secrets-rotation utility, that you should know about. Rotation intervals are now configurable per credential class instead of one global timer, and failed rotations retry with backoff rather than silently giving up (yes, really, that was a thing). We also added a dry-run flag so you can preview what would rotate — use it liberally. Questions about any of these changes should go to the release owner, whose name appears below.

named custodian: Belius Casath Ulaix Sorius

Handover: Thorngate retention sweeper

Before you review, note that the sweeper hard-deletes records past their retention window nightly, with a dry-run mode I left enabled in staging. Deletions are logged with record counts only, never payloads, per the Mirevale audit policy. The sweeper reads its schedule and thresholds from the settings shown directly below.

service settings:
PRAIX_LOG_LEVEL=error
PRAIX_METRICS_HOST=metrics.praix.qorvelcorp.corp
PRAIX_POOL_SIZE=16

Subject: Cage visit — Thursday

New starters attending Thursday's data-centre walkthrough at the Kelverton site: arrive at the front desk by 09:45. Bring photo ID. No bags past the mantrap; lockers provided. You'll be escorted at all times inside the cage area — do not touch racks. Hard hats not required, closed shoes are. Sign the visitor log on arrival and departure. The escort door needs a pass code, which is below.

— Front Desk, Kelverton

badge for fawip-kafof: bdg-TMT-0

TICKET-4412: Vault locked — Gatewick turnstile counter config

The secrets vault holding the ingest credentials for the Gatewick stadium turnstile counter sealed itself after three failed unlock attempts during last night's node reboot. Until it is unsealed, turnstile tallies from the north concourse are buffering locally and the capacity dashboard is stale. On-call should unseal the vault on the primary node before the Saturday fixture. The recovery passphrase for the unseal operation follows.

vault phrase of tawig-taduf = zorath-oliwyn